About the Guest – Edouardo Vitale:
Edouardo Vitale is a Miami-based engineer turned entrepreneur and the founder of Olympus AI. Passionate about mental clarity and daily action, Edouardo created Olympus AI to help users turn social media inspiration into tangible lifestyle improvements. His work merges tech, wellness, and intention in a way that’s already reshaping how we use our digital habits for better mental health.

Key Takeaways :

  • Olympus AI transforms social media saves—like travel, recipes, fitness tips—into action plans by using AI to break down content and tie it to daily life.

  • The app features five journaling chapters (Work, Health, Self, Relationships, Goals), uses voice input for ease, and doesn’t store private data, ensuring user confidentiality.

  • Olympus AI helps users identify emotional patterns, influencers in their lives, and emotional triggers using voice logs and journaling insights.

  • Users reported emotional relief just from speaking into the app—similar to a therapy session—making it a tool for stress release, not just productivity.

  • From planning trips and managing relationships to learning golf techniques, Olympus AI adapts to individual needs and preferences.

  • Edouardo’s vision includes community-based features and custom journaling categories, signaling a powerful roadmap for the platform’s growth.
